Description (1S,8R,11S,18R,21S,24R)-10,11-dimethyl-21-(2-methylpropyl)-24-(propan-2-yl)-3,4,10,13,14,20,23,26,27-nonaazatetracyclo[24.4.0.03,8.013,18]triacontane-2,9,12,19,22,25-hexaone is found in Streptomyces and Streptomyces hygroscopicus. Based on a literature review very few articles have been published on CHEMBL3088122.
